UPM is one of the world's leading pulp producers. We supply global customers with eucalyptus and softwood pulps in end use segments such as tissue, specialty, packaging and graphic papers and board, through our own sales and service networks close to customers in the APAC region, Europe and Americas. UPM Pulp operates five pulp mills – three in Finland and two in Uruguay – as well as certified eucalyptus plantations in Uruguay. We employ approximately 1,800 people. The annual pulp production capacity is 5.8 million tonnes. Pulp business is part of the UPM Fibres Business Area which combines the integrated production of pulp, energy and sawn timber with a synergistic supply chain of wood raw materials. upmpulp.com
